Connie Ferguson was born on June 10, 1970, in Soweto, South Africa.

She began her career in the early 1990s, quickly rising to fame as an actress in the popular soap opera “Generations.

” Her talent and charisma captured the hearts of many, leading her to become one of the most recognized faces in the industry.

Beyond acting, Ferguson has made significant strides as a producer, launching Ferguson Films, which has produced numerous successful television series and films.

Despite her professional achievements, Connie’s personal life has faced its share of challenges.

She experienced profound loss when her husband, Shona Ferguson, passed away in July 2021 due to complications from COVID-19.

This heartbreaking event left a significant impact on her and their family, including their daughters, Alicia and Lesedi.
